This evening I removed the masking paper and tape from the inside of the fuselage. The paint job looks pretty good!
Over the past few months, I've been hearing some small objects rolling around under the forward floorboards as I rotated the fuselage. This evening I inserted a high-pressure air line with a rubber tip into the nooks and crannies and blew out four un-driven rivets, one drilled-out rivet, and one brand-new nutplate -- a few remnants from the QB construction process, I suppose.
